What is the appropriate way to construct JAR files that depend on wso2
classes/jars at runtime?

Here's why I ask...  I'm working on writing a custom OAuth validation
callback handler per
blog.thilinamb.com/2012/08/writing-oauthcallbackhandler-for-wso2_7.html .

I can compile my class against the appropriate WSO2 jar's allows me to
create my own jar which I copy into repository/components/extensions/.
After which, I restart WSO2,  but upon it trying to use my callback handler
I receive the ClassNotFoundException
on org.wso2.carbon.identity.oauth.callback.AbstractOAuthCallbackHandler.

I believe that this is due to my jar not being OSGi-compatible, but I'm not
100% sure.

Any ideas?
